The Messenger of Allah ﷺ taught us to say when we sit after two units of prayer, "All greetings, prayers, and good deeds belong to Allah. Peace be upon you, Prophet, and the mercy of Allah and His blessings. Peace be upon us and upon the righteous servants of Allah. I bear witness that there is no god but Allah, and I bear witness that Muhammad is His servant and messenger."

Sahih. Tirmidhi reported it in the book of prayer, chapter on what has been said about the tashahhud, hadith 289, from Yaqub bin Ibrahim, by this route, and it is also in Kubra, hadith 748. Its basic content is agreed upon, reported by Bukhari, hadith 6230, 835, 831, and Muslim, hadith 402.
